Frequency-Induced Finishing Complete Overview of Material & Metal Finishing

Vibratory finishing is an competent method for achieving a glossy surface on a range of elements. This process involves agitating workpieces within a container filled with media and a wetting agent. The constant vibration causes the media to strike against the parts, gradually removing imperfections and smoothing their exterior. Vibratory finishing is widely exploited in industries such as auto fabrication, where precise surface standard is crucial.

  • Benefits of vibratory finishing include its ability to achieve a consistent and high-quality refinement.
  • In addition, it can be used to deburr parts, remove rust and corrosion, and improve the overall look of metal objects.
  • Operations of vibratory finishing range from vehicle pieces to larger equipment.

Revolving Disc Conditional Finishing

Centrifugal disc finishing offers a meticulous method for removing edges and leveling surfaces on a variety of materials. The process utilizes a rotating disc with abrasive particles that rapidly act upon the workpiece as it is spun within the disc's path. This impelling action tumbles material, achieving a desired level of sharpness.

Applications for centrifugal disc finishing are diverse, ranging from aerospace manufacturing to electronics. The process is particularly valuable when intricate designs require attention.

Vibratory Finishing: Choosing the Right Process

When it comes to achieving smooth, polished components, vibratory and centrifugal finishing stand out as two popular methods. Both processes utilize agitation and abrasion to remove scratches. However, they differ in their mechanisms and are better suited for various applications. Vibratory finishing employs a quivering bowl filled with media and parts, creating a chaotic motion that abrades the surface. Centrifugal finishing, on the other hand, uses centrifugal force within a rotating chamber to achieve the same result. The choice between these two processes ultimately depends on factors such as the configuration of the parts, the desired level of finish, and production quantity.

  • Assess the details of your project. Vibratory finishing is often preferred for smaller, intricate parts, while centrifugal finishing is more suitable for larger components.
  • Gauge the desired level of surface smoothness. Vibratory finishing can achieve a finer finish than centrifugal finishing.
  • Reflect on production parameters. Centrifugal finishing typically offers higher capacity than vibratory finishing.

Technical Overview of Vibratory Polishing Instruments: Elevating Surface Performance

Vibratory polishing machines utilize a unique system to achieve exceptional surface quality. These machines exploit high-frequency vibrations, which vibrate abrasive media in a contained vessel. This process effectively polishes the surface of workpiece materials, producing a smoother finish. The vibratory motion assures even abrasion across the entire surface, clearing surface imperfections and achieving a high level of uniformity.

  • Leading positives of vibratory polishing include increased surface finish, removal of burrs and sharp edges, improved dimensional accuracy, and enhanced corrosion resistance.
  • As well, vibratory polishing is a versatile process suitable for a wide range of materials, including metals, ceramics, plastics, and glass.

The science behind vibratory polishing lies in the interplay between vibrations, abrasive media, and material properties. The speed of vibration, the type and size of abrasive media, and the duration of the polishing process all affect the final surface quality. Through careful tuning of these parameters, manufacturers can achieve desired surface finishes for a variety of applications.
